San Diego is a vivacious and active food community whose eating habits are unpretentious yet familiar, conspicuous yet simple. Famous for supporting a health-conscious lifestyle, with an abundant supply of fresh and organic products at their fingertips, the attitude of the chefs and diners alike is friendly and laid-back. From celebrity top chefs and James Beard Award Winners to experienced chefs who simply just love to cook, priding themselves on being eco-conscious, using only sustainable meats and seafood, the restaurants in San Diego are quickly becoming enchanting places, suitable for even the most discerning of palates. The the colorful California modern cuisine will tempt your taste buds with fusions of imaginative textures and flavors. With recipes for the home cook from over 60 of the city's most celebrated restaurants and showcasing around full-color photos featuring mouth-watering dishes, famous chefs, and lots of local flavor, San Diego Chef's Table is the ultimate gift and keepsake cookbook.

About the Author
Maria Desiderata Montana is the publisher of the award-winning food blog San Diego Food Finds (sandiegofoodfinds.com). She is also a published author, editor, and award-winning freelance food and wine journalist who learned how to cook and appreciate European cuisine from her parents, who were born and raised in Calabria, Italy. Maria is the author of Food Lovers' Guide to San Diego (Globe Pequot Press) and The Inn at Rancho Santa Fe Cookbook. She was also a contributing editor of the award-winning cookbook Flying Pans. She has been a regular contributor to U-T San Diego since 2005, where she has written a variety of food and entertainment stories, as well as her own monthly “Step by Step” recipe series. She loves to cook and create new recipes and strongly believes that eating with family and friends is a celebration of life itself. She lives in San Diego with her husband, John, and their two children, Lucia and Frank.
